The Basics of Math For First Graders
The basics of math for first graders include reading and counting numbers from 20 to 120, and understanding place value. A two-digit number contains seven tens on the left side and nine ones on the right side. One ten is equal to ten, two tens is equal to twenty, and so on. Children can count change and estimate travel time with the help of math. Moreover, they can learn to recognize fractions.
The concept of place value and equal shares is introduced by breaking larger numbers into smaller parts. The term “Teens” is used to describe a Subtraction strategy, and the concept of Place Value is supported by a game that teaches students how to add and subtract from smaller numbers. Telling time is another essential skill in first grade. Students will learn to tell time to the half-hour, quarter-hour, and half-hour increments. They may also learn to tell time in five-minute increments with digital and analog clocks. They may also begin to learn about elapsed time, which will come in handy later.
The basics of geometry are also important to first-grade math. For example, children should know how to recognize 2D shapes and their basic attributes. They should also be able to partition shapes into halves and fourths using traditional measuring instruments. Once this foundation has been laid, students can move on to learn about 3-D shapes.
